Optimal STBC Precoding with Channel Covariance Feedback for Minimum Error Probability
<p/> <p>This paper develops the optimal linear transformation (or precoding) of orthogonal space-time block codes (STBC) for minimizing probability of decoding error, when the channel covariance matrix is available at the transmitter. We build on recent work that stated the performance c...
